Moise TREMBLAY was born 14 June 1810 in Baie-Saint-Paul, Lower Canada
Moise TREMBLAY was the child of Moise TREMBLAY and Marie LAVOIE and the grandchild of: (paternal) Honore-Saveur TREMBLAY and Marie-Agathe GIRARD (maternal) Laurent LAVOIE and Marie-Procule BELLEYSpou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Moise married Lucille MENARD 16 November 1830 in Baie-Saint-Paul, Lower Canada .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Lucille MENARD was born 11 June 1808 in Baie-Saint-Paul, Québec, Canada (Saint-Pierre-et-Saint-Paul-de-Baie-Saint-Paul). Lucille died abt. 1885 in Saint-Urbain, Charlevoix, Québec, Canada. Lucille was the child of Pierre MENARD and Marie-Angélique GIRARD.
Moise TREMBLAY died 12 January 1883 in Saint-Urbain, Charlevoix, Québec, Canada.

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
